Oregon Probate Law and Its Impact on Estate Distribution
Oregon’s probate laws play a pivotal role in guiding the administration and eventual estate distribution in Multnomah County and beyond. When a will is contested or an individual passes away without one, the court steps in to oversee the settlement of the estate. This process involves interpreting the deceased’s wishes as expressed in legal documents, such as a will or trust. The state’s probate law dictates how assets are identified, valued, and distributed among the beneficiaries named in these legal instruments.
